Abstract
In the title complex, [Mn(C₆H₂N₃O₇)₂(C₃₀H₂₆N₄O)], the Mn(II) atom is coordinated by the tridentate bis-benzimidazole ligand and two atoms of the picrate anions, in a distorted square-pyramidal geometry (τ = 0.038). One nitro O atom of one picrate ion is disordered over two sites with occupancies of 0.54 (5) and 0.46 (5).Entities:
